Why was Mao Zedong’s communist China ready to use military tactics against the troops of US general Douglas MacArthur in Korea?

<span>Mao Zedong was ready to use military force on US UN troops to stop the foreign agenda of ending Communism in North Korea and China. Communist China was recovering from a history of war and, therefore, could not enter another war especially against the Allied forces of US, Britain, and the Soviet Union. However, Mao Zedong new that if the US subdued and ended communism in North Korea, China would be next. Therefore, Communist China deployed troops in North Korea forcing the US troops to retreat.  </span>

What is the name of the actions taken by the British to take American sailors from their ships and force them to join the Britis
uysha [10]

Answer:

Impressment of sailors was the practice of Britain's Royal Navy of sending officers to board American ships, inspect the crew, and seize sailors accused of being deserters from British ships. Incidents of impressment are often cited as one of the causes of the War of 1812.
